            Engine Displacement:
        
        
            1085 cc (approx. 1100 cc)
        
     
    
        
            Engine Configuration:
        
        
            Horizontally opposed twin-cylinder ('Boxer')
        
     
    
        
            Bore X Stroke:
        
        
            99 mm x 70.5 mm
        
     
    
        
            Compression Ratio:
        
        
            10.0:1
        
     
    
        
            Valve Train:
        
        
            2 valves per cylinder, overhead camshaft (OHC), pushrod actuation with rocker arms.
        
     
    
    
        
            Horsepower Typical:
        
        
            90-95 hp @ 7250 rpm (varies slightly by model)
        
     
    
        
            Torque Typical:
        
        
            98-100 Nm (72-74 lb-ft) @ 5500 rpm (varies slightly by model)
        
     
    
    
        
            Fuel Induction:
        
        
            Bosch Motronic 2.2 or 2.4 electronic fuel injection
        
     
    
        
            Fuel Type:
        
        
            Unleaded gasoline, minimum 91 RON (87 AKI)
        
     
    
        
            Fuel Tank Capacity Typical:
        
        
            25 Liters (6.6 US gal) for RT/RS, 20-25 Liters for GS/R
        
     
 
    
    
    
        
            Oil And Filter Change:
        
        
            Every 10,000 km (6,000 miles) or annually.
        
     
    
        
            Valve Adjustment:
        
        
            Every 20,000 km (12,000 miles).
        
     
    
        
            Gearbox Oil Change:
        
        
            Every 20,000 km (12,000 miles).
        
     
    
        
            Final Drive Oil Change:
        
        
            Every 20,000 km (12,000 miles).
        
     
    
        
            Brake Fluid Flush:
        
        
            Every 2 years.
        
     
    
    
        
            Engine Oil Type:
        
        
            SAE 20W-50 or 15W-50 (API SG or higher, JASO MA compatible). Check owner's manual for specific BMW recommendations.
        
     
    
        
            Engine Oil Capacity:
        
        
            Approx. 4.0 Liters (4.2 US qt) with filter change.
        
     
    
    
    
        
            Hall Effect Sender Failure:
        
        
            Failure of the Hall effect sensor in the distributor unit can lead to starting or running problems.
        
     
    
        
            Fuel Pump Relay:
        
        
            Relays can fail, leading to no fuel delivery.
        
     
    
        
            Fuel Line Cracking:
        
        
            Older fuel lines can become brittle and leak.
        
     
    
        
            ABS Modulator Faults:
        
        
            ABS modulators can develop faults, especially with age, leading to ABS warning lights or malfunction.
        
     
    
        
            Clutch Actuator Seal:
        
        
            Leaking clutch actuator seal can cause clutch drag.

            R1100 Series Introduction:
        
        
            The R1100 series marked a significant technological leap for BMW, introducing the four-valve per cylinder boxer engine, fuel injection, and the Paralever rear suspension across multiple model variants.
        
     
    
        
            R1100Rt:
        
        
            Flagship touring model with full fairing, adjustable windscreen, and comfortable ergonomics for long-distance travel.
        
     
    
        
            R1100Rs:
        
        
            Sport-touring model with a partially faired design offering a balance between comfort and sportiness.
        
     
    
        
            R1100Gs:
        
        
            Iconic adventure-touring motorcycle, renowned for its versatility, long-travel suspension, and ability to handle varied terrain.
        
     
    
        
            R1100R:
        
        
            Naked/standard motorcycle with a more minimalist design, showcasing the boxer engine.
        
     
    
    
        
            Production Years:
        
        
            R1100 series production ran from approximately 1993 (RS/RT) through 2001 (GS), with the R1150 series taking over thereafter.
